Cowlings for marine drives and latching devices for cowlings for marine drives

A cowling is for a marine drive. The cowling has first and second cowl portions for enclosing a powerhead, and a latching device which is movable into a latched position in which the powerhead is enclosed by the first cowl and second cowl portions and an unlatched position in which the second cowl portion is movable with respect to the first cowl portion so that the powerhead is accessible. The latching device has an electric actuator configured to automatically move the latching device from the latched position to the unlatched position and a manually-operable input device which is accessible from outside of the cowling and is configured to actuate the electric actuator to thereby automatically move the latching device from the latched position to the unlatched position.

Double pull closure latch for front trunk having emergency release

A latch assembly having an emergency auxiliary release member located in a stowage compartment of a motor vehicle, such as a front trunk, is provided. The latch assembly has a coupling lever that is actuatable to move to a disengaged position if a predetermined condition is met, such as and engine on/off condition or a vehicle speed condition, for example, whereupon the latch assembly is prevented from being fully release, but only allows the latch assembly to move to a partially released state. Upon the predetermined condition be absent, the coupling lever is returned to a position such that the latch assembly can then be fully released from either a passenger compartment of the vehicle or the trunk.

Locking structure for a rectilinear center rail for opposite sliding doors

A locking structure for a rectilinear center rail is provided. The locking structure includes a rectilinear center rail mounted on a sliding door, a center roller unit rollably connected to the center rail, and a center swing arm rotatably connected to the center roller unit and a vehicle body. The center roller unit includes a first lever and a second lever that are configured to rotate about rotation axes formed in a width direction of the center rail. The locking structure is configured to switch between a first posture in which the first lever is configured to be caught by a catching portion formed on the center rail, rotated, and then locked with the second lever and a second posture in which the second lever is configured to be caught by a catching portion formed on the center swing arm, rotated, and then locked with the first lever.

Two-stage open tailgate

A two-stage open tailgate includes a handle assembly disposed at an outer surface of a half door, wherein the half door is opened when the handle assembly performs a first operation, a full door disposed at a rear surface of the half door and opened in an integrated state with the half door when the handle assembly performs a second operation, a first striker mounted to one end of the half door, a second striker mounted to a vehicle body such that the second striker is disposed adjacent to the first striker in a closed state of the half door, a dual latch formed at one end of the full door at positions respectively corresponding to the first striker and the second striker, wherein the handle assembly and the dual latch are spaced apart from each other when the half door is opened.

Hood lock apparatus

A hood lock apparatus includes a base plate having a striker groove into which a striker enters in response to a closing operation of a hood, a latch locking the striker entered into the striker groove, a locking plate locking the latch that locks the striker, a rattle lever supporting the striker locked by the latch with the latch, and a rattle spring biasing the rattle lever holding the striker with the latch towards the striker. The rattle spring is disposed to straddle a first center line passing through a rotational shaft of the rattle lever and extending in a direction at right angles to a direction in which the striker groove extends.

Dual actuated latch mechanism for a vehicle

A vehicle hood latching mechanism, having a latch member pivotally connected to a housing defining a striker channel. The latch member includes a primary catch portion between the intersection of a first lever arm and a second lever arm, a secondary catch portion on the first lever arm facing the primary catch portion, and a latch cam surface on the second lever arm proximal to the primary catch portion. The latch cam surface is configured such that a force applied onto the latch cam surface causes the latch member to pivot to a first position. A cancel lever is pivotally mounted to an end of the second lever arm of the latch member and includes an exterior cam surface configured such that a force applied onto the exterior cam surface induces a moment M onto the second lever arm causing the latch member to rotate into the first position.
